I'm just being honest, but I don't hate the artists, I hate the investors that actually pay the money and hand out careers to people who stand in their bathroom and copy a look they saw on a celebrity. The REAL paid talent is the artists who invented those looks and actually implemented them. Where are their videos? I don't want to watch a video of someone putting makeup on unless it's someone with something new to offer.

I spend time watching videos from Petrilude and there are a lot of other really good drag videos that show techniques for covering eyebrows, sculpting the face, etc. Art and technique. I do tutorials and videos and blog about makeup.. and yes people are interested in basic eyeshadow application and what MAC brush does what.. but I am not trying to make a career out of it, it's just for fun. I don't expect experienced makeup artists to waste their time reading my tutorials, either. In fact, I'd rather be putting makeup on people and video taping it, but all of my friends are so damned shy!

I am not sure why Sephora gave Lauren Luke her own line of cosmetics, that is going just a bit far, don't you think? Same with Kat Von D... I would have thought Pixie from LA Ink would get her own makeup line first. It's all about investing who has the most fan-base, no matter what talent they have. You see the same thing happening with music, too. The next "hot" thing is never the best thing, and it doesn't last in most cases. As for the jealousy issue.. hell yeah, I am jealous. Every time I log into Temptalia, she's got 100 new lip glosses. Wow. I would LOVE to have that lifestyle.
